KUCCPS Releases List Of Support Centres For Course Revision

KUCCPS announced on Tuesday that applicants seeking guidance for their first course revision should visit the designated institutions before April 4.

Below are the centres in different counties.

Baringo – Baringo Technical College Bomet and SOT Technical Training Institute.

Bungoma – Kisiwa Technical Training Institute

Busia – Alupe University.

Elgeyo Marakwet -Kapcherop Technical and Vocational College.

Embu – Jeremiah Nyaga Technical Training Institute

Garissa – Ijara Technical and Vocational College for assistance.

Homabay – Tom Mboya University.

Isiolo – Samburu Technical and Vocational College.

Kajiado – Ngong Technical and Vocational College.

Kakamega – Masinde Muliro University of Science and Technology and Shamberere Technical Training Institute.

Kericho – Kericho Township Technical and Vocational College.

Kiambu – Kiambu National Polytechnic and Thika Technical Training Institute.

Kilifi – Pwani University.

Kirinyaga – Mwea Technical and Vocational College.

Kisii – Orogare Technical and Vocational College.

Kisumu – Nyakach Technical and Vocational College and Ramogi Institute of Science and Technology.

Kitui – Mulango Technical and Vocational College.

Kwale – Kinango Technical and Vocational College.

Laikipia students – Laikipia West Technical and Vocational College.

Lamu – Lamu East Technical and Vocational College.

Machakos – Machakos Institute for the Blind.

Makueni – Kibwezi West Technical Training Institute.

Mandera – El-Wak Technical and Vocational College.

Marsabit – Laisamis Technical and Vocational College.

Meru – Nkabune Technical Training Institute.

Migori – Siala Technical Training Institute.

Mombasa – Likoni Technical and Vocational College.

Mombasa – Technical University of Mombasa.

Murang’a – Mathioya Technical and Vocational College.

Nairobi – Nairobi Technical Training Institute.

Nakuru – Rift Valley Institute of Science and Technology.

Nandi – Aldai Technical Training Institute.

Narok – Maasai Mara University.

Nyamira – Kitutu Masaba TVC.

Nyandarua – Kipipiri Technical and Vocational College.

Nyeri – Nyeri National Polytechnic.

Samburu – Maralal Technical and Vocational College.

Siaya – Ugunja Technical and Vocational College.

Taita Taveta – Mwatate Technical and Vocational College.

Tana River – Tana River Technical and Vocational College.

Tharaka Nithi – Tharaka University College.

Trans-Nzoia – Kiminini Technical and Vocational College.

Turkana – Turkana University College.

Uasin Gishu – Rift Valley Technical Training College.

Vihiga – Friends College Kaimosi College.

Wajir- Wajir East Technical and Vocational College.

West Pokot – Kitelakapel Technical and Vocational College.

The KUCCPS opened its portal to allow students to revise their courses on March 19.

The Kenya Universities and Colleges Central Placement Service said the portal will remain open until April 4, 2024.
